Responsibilities:

  • Conduct comprehensive speech and language evaluations for students.
  • Develop individualized treatment plans and goals to address communication disorders.
  • Provide therapeutic interventions through individual and group therapy sessions to support students' speech and language development.
  • Collaborate with teachers, parents, and other school professionals to create a collaborative approach to student care.
  • Monitor and document students' progress regularly, making adjustments to therapy strategies as needed.
  • Actively participate in Individualized Education Program (IEP) meetings to contribute valuable insights.

Requirements:

  • Master's degree in Speech-Language Pathology or Communication Disorders.
  • ASHA (American Speech-Language-Hearing Association) certification (CCC-SLP) or eligibility for certification.
  • Valid state licensure as a Speech-Language Pathologist in Maine.
  • Previous experience in a school or pediatric setting is advantageous, though new graduates are welcome to apply.
